The cheapest way to get from Bacoor to Candaba is to bus and train which costs ₱380 - ₱480 and takes 3h 38m.
The fastest way to get from Bacoor to Candaba is to drive which takes 1h 27m and costs ₱650 - ₱1,000.
No, there is no direct bus from Bacoor to Candaba. However, there are services departing from Emilio Aguinaldo Hwy, Bacoor City, Manila and arriving at Santa Ana via FNLT Bus Station Caloocan.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 5h 7m.
The distance between Bacoor and Candaba is 194 km. The road distance is 86.6 km.
The best way to get from Bacoor to Candaba without a car is to bus and train which takes 3h 38m and costs ₱380 - ₱480.
It takes approximately 3h 38m to get from Bacoor to Candaba, including transfers.
